Spider-Man: Brand New Day Just Became the Biggest Domestic Opening Weekend Ever — Here's What Actually Happened

Tom Holland's web-slinger has done something no Marvel movie has managed before: he's knocked Avengers: Endgame off its own throne.

Spider-Man: Brand New Day opened in North American theatres to an eye-watering $168 million on day one alone, and by the time the weekend numbers were tallied, it had officially claimed the title of the biggest domestic opening weekend in box office history — nudging past the record Endgame set back in 2019.

If that sounds like a straightforward story, it wasn't quite that simple as it unfolded. Box office reporting almost always moves in stages — Friday numbers, then Sunday estimates, then Monday's "actuals" — and this weekend was a good example of why fans shouldn't treat the first headline as the final word.

The numbers kept climbing all weekend

On Saturday, early estimates suggested Spidey had come agonizingly close to Endgame's record but hadn't quite gotten there. By Sunday, the picture looked even stronger: a combined worldwide opening of roughly $927 million, good enough for the second-biggest global opening weekend ever recorded, trailing only Endgame itself.

Then came the actual, finalized domestic figures a day later — and that's when the record officially fell. Brand New Day didn't just come close to Endgame's domestic haul; it beat it outright, making this the biggest opening weekend in North American history, full stop.

It's a reminder that "record broken" stories in the film industry often get reported in real time, before the studios have crunched the final ticket-sale figures. The headline on day one (huge, but not quite there) and the headline on day three (officially the biggest ever) were both true — just at different points in the counting process.

Why this one landed so hard

A few things clearly worked in the film's favor. Holland returning as Peter Parker for what's being billed as a defining chapter of his run, a marketing push that leaned hard into nostalgia for the character, and a fairly empty release calendar around it all seem to have combined into the kind of "event" opening that Hollywood rarely manages to produce more than once or twice a year.

For a franchise that some had started to write off as oversaturated, this weekend is a pretty firm rebuttal. Superhero fatigue, it turns out, has its limits — especially when the studio pairs the right actor with the right character at the right moment.

The bigger story might be what comes next

Buried inside the film is a plot thread that could matter a lot more than the opening-weekend numbers. Peter Parker reportedly develops technology in the movie designed to keep his own powers under control — tech that, going by early reactions, looks like it could be repurposed by the Sentinels as a weapon against the X-Men down the line.

That's a fairly loaded detail to drop in a Spider-Man movie, and it's already got fans connecting dots toward Avengers: Doomsday. If Marvel is planting a seed here, it's a much bigger one than "biggest opening weekend ever" — box office records get broken eventually, but a Sentinel-vs-X-Men setup baked into the MCU's next mega-crossover is the kind of thing that shapes years of storytelling.

The takeaway

Spider-Man: Brand New Day is now the biggest domestic opening weekend of all time and the second-biggest global opening weekend ever, trailing only Avengers: Endgame. Whether it can hold onto momentum in the weeks ahead — and whether that Sentinel tech becomes a genuine plot point in Doomsday — is what'll actually decide how this movie is remembered a year from now.
